CVE-2025-12515: Systemic Internal Server Errors - HTTP 500 Response

Published Oct 30, 2025
·
Updated

Systemic Internal Server Errors - HTTP 500 ResponseThis issue affects BLU-IC2: through 1.19.5; BLU-IC4: through 1.19.5 .

Affected Software

6 affected components
BLU BLU-IC2<=1.19.5
BLU BLU-IC4<=1.19.5

Frequently Asked Questions

1

What is the severity of CVE-2025-12515?

CVE-2025-12515 is classified as a high severity vulnerability due to its potential to cause systemic internal server errors.

2

How do I fix CVE-2025-12515?

To fix CVE-2025-12515, it is recommended to upgrade BLU-IC2 and BLU-IC4 to version 1.19.6 or later.

3

What products are affected by CVE-2025-12515?

CVE-2025-12515 affects BLU-IC2 and BLU-IC4, both up to and including version 1.19.5.

4

What are the symptoms of CVE-2025-12515?

The primary symptom of CVE-2025-12515 is experiencing HTTP 500 Internal Server Errors when using affected versions.

5

Is CVE-2025-12515 actively exploited?

As of now, there is no public information indicating that CVE-2025-12515 is actively being exploited in the wild.
